Output 66b052ba3fc01f82adceaf123bd6f9903d78bf366620ba264d005a84e3632171:70

value
18208819664
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b0f2a30298b68ca394317a9f7ca209d4d4bc1dac OP_EQUALVERIFY OP_CHECKSIG
address
1H8cbTfMjnBBMDrqS8QZJm8qWqUE1B883B
transaction
66b052ba3fc01f82adceaf123bd6f9903d78bf366620ba264d005a84e3632171
spent
true